DEBIAN-CVE-2016-8655
Race condition in net/packet/afpacket.c in the Linux kernel through 4.8.12 allows local users to gain privileges or cause a denial of service use-after-free by leveraging the CAPNETRAW capability to change a socket version, related to the packetsetring and packetsetsockopt functions...
